Creating a dedicated workspace requires more than just a desk and a chair. It also involves setting boundaries and establishing a routine that fosters productivity. This can include minimizing distractions, using noise-cancelling headphones, and taking regular breaks to stay energized. For remote workers, a dedicated workspace also provides a sense of separation between work and personal life, which can help prevent burnout and maintain a healthy work-life balance.
